Sales have declined for nine consecutive quarters, and component sourcing costs have doubled since the Quillmark facility closed. We propose ending new orders at year-end, with spares support for thirty months. Migration incentives toward the Aldric platform are costed and attached. Customer communications are drafted; staff redeployment is handled through the Merrow programme. Approval is requested at this review. The confidential commentary on forward business plans is set out immediately below.

management briefing: Silethax Systems plans to raise the Holix list price by 50.2 percent in December. The steering committee signed off on a budget of $329.9 million for Project Holok. The renewal with Juldorax Foods closes at $278.2 million a year, 54.3 percent above the last contract. Project Briir slips by one quarter because of the supplier delay.

Subject: Partner SFTP drop — schedule change

Hi plugin authors,

The nightly partner drop to the Corvane SFTP endpoint now runs an hour earlier to accommodate the Bellwick ingestion window. If your plugin polls the drop folder, update your schedule accordingly; files landing after the cutoff roll to the next cycle. The release carrying this change is identified by the token below.

build token for kagaf-hahof: htk14_9d3d4d26d7d8de

// Nightly search reindex for the Corvel platform.
// The job drains the staging index, rebuilds from the canonical
// store, then swaps aliases atomically. If the rebuild exceeds the
// wall-clock budget, it aborts and the previous index stays live,
// so a failed run is safe but must be flagged in the release notes.
// Batch sizing and concurrency were last tuned after the Q3 load
// tests on the Brindlewood cluster. Adjust only with a sign-off.
// The constants governing the run are as follows.

constants for fajop-tahaf:
RATE_LIMITS = {
    "holael": 2,
    "oliael": 10,
    "druael": 10,
    "wenwyn": 10,
}

Hey plugin folks, welcome to the Monthvault ecosystem! Quick context: our event tables are partitioned by month, so your plugin queries should always include a date range or they'll scan everything and make the Shardwick cluster sad. Partitions older than 13 months roll to cold storage automatically. To query the partition metadata API, authenticate with the key below.

app token of yajeg-kawef = kto11_7En3XSX8xQw